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can clean up the spill and dry the area yourself.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es You need professional help to extract the water and prevent further dam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es You need professional help to dry and repair the drywall.
Mold growth in attic No Yes You need professional help to remove the mold and prevent its return.
Roof leak repair No Yes You need professional help to inspect and repair your roof.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es You need professional help to extract the water and prevent further damage.

Storm Damage Restoration Cost In The 55323 Area

The cost of storm damage restoration in the 55323 area var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ience with storm damage restoration in the area.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and complexity of drying process
Mold Remediation $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area and type of mold
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repair
Roof Leak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repair
Insurance Claims Help $500 – $2,000 Complexity of claims process and number of insurance claims

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the severity of the damage and local conditions.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a plan that fits your budget and needs.
